What You’ll Be Doing

1. The role is focused on the operational management of buildings and associated FM staff, to ensure they are safe and available for use by service teams.
2. The role will require the successful candidate to manage:
3. a flexible assigned portfolio of sites from within the corporate estate, which includes a wide variety of building types.
4. a team of facilities staff that covers your portfolio of sites
5. the performance of contract partners and in-house teams that undertake repairs and servicing
6. the compliance of your portfolio, principally relating to fire safety, legionella control and asbestos management
7. liaison with the users and stakeholders, in an effective manner, so they can fulfil their service delivery requirements to the people of Sheffield.
